Ministry of Health gives go ahead for 16-17 year olds to be vaccinated against COVID-19

The Ministry of Health has given the go ahead for the ages 16-17 to be vaccinated with mRNA technology vaccines.

 

The decision was taken in an effort to further protect public health against COVID-19 and after recommendations of the Cyprus Paediatric Society. The Vaccination portal will open for these ages from Wednesday, 30 June at 07:30.

 

According to the Ministry, the appointments will be booked by the parents/guardians or personal doctors, in consultation with the children’s parents/guardians.

 

When visiting the Vaccination centres, the children should present a letter of consent from parents/guardians for vaccination, signed by both parents unless by law this is not required (a court decision is necessary).
